Poland’s First Institutional Venture Capital Fund Dedicated to Life Science Announces First Closing At $ 42 Million

Poland’s First Institutional Venture Capital Fund Dedicated to Life Science Announces First Closing At $ 42 Million

Dr. Marek Orlowski leads team of seasoned life science investment experts operating out of Warsaw to invest in promising Central and Eastern European Life Science companies

Warsaw, Poland, March 23, 2015 / B3C newswire / —  Joint Polish Investment Fund Management (JPIF) announced today the first closing of its new venture capital fund, Joined Polish Investment Fund I at $ 42 Million.

It is the first institutional venture capital fund operating out of Poland that is completely dedicated to life science investments. The fund will invest in early- and mid-stage companies with a close relationship to Poland and marks an important milestone on the country’s path to further strengthen its life science industry.

Investment activities will focus on areas with strong growth, relatively short holding periods and high return potential e.g. companies in the area of medical technology, enabling technology or mobile health.
